Compostable Leaf Bags Available for Purchase

Recology Ashland offers sets of five compostable bags for leaves only year-round for $14.50, which includes curbside collection of the bags. General inquiries may be directed to customerservice103@recology.com.

 

Each bag is nearly three feet tall and holds up to 35 pounds of leaves. For two weeks only, from October 17th - October 28th, sets of bags will be discounted at $10. There is a two-set limit at this price.

 

The compostable bags for leaves only are collected curbside in Ashland and Talent on regular Green Debris service days. Those who do not subscribe to Recology Ashland’s Green Debris service may email customerservice103@recology.com to schedule their pickup. Bags may be used all throughout the year.

 

Recology will host three free community leaf collection events this Fall. In Ashland, two events on Sunday November 20th and December 11th from 10-3 will take place at a new location: the Ashland Police Station parking lot - 1195 East Main Street. In Talent, one event will take place on Saturday December 3rd from 10-3 at Talent City Hall - 110 East Main Street. Participants are asked to arrive with their identification and to take their empty bags of leaves back home with them.

 

Leaves collected during Ashland & Talent’s community leaf collection events reduce fire risk to the community, maintain storm drain health, and provide the nutrient-rich donation of leaves to local farmers in each city. Those interested in receiving leaves may email jrosenthal@recology.com.
